Description

These Begonia grandiflora have significant growth, up to about 40 centimetres, and bear large double flowers. Superb in shaded situations, in a pot or in the ground. Its fleshy foliage and compact habit are often used as a border plant, or in a pot or hanging basket.

We offer you this collection of 15 begonias: 3 white, 3 salmon, 3 yellow, 3 pink, and 3 red.

These tuberous begonias are delivered in large bulbs (7+). This size guarantees very good flowering.

Planting and care

Plant your begonias in a shade or dappled sun, in light and moist soil rich in humus. Begonias dislike heavy soils, so lighten it if necessary with sand. Plant after the last frost: one per 20cm pot, or spaced 25 centimetres (10 inches) apart in open ground. Plant the bulb with the hollow side up, and cover with 5cm (2in) of soil. Like dahlias, you can speed up their growth cycle by planting them as early as February in a pot, keeping them sheltered, and taking them out in May. Water regularly. Apply begonia fertiliser at planting, then twice a month during the season. Remove faded flowers. Dig up the bulbs before the first frost, and store them in a bit of soil in a dry and cool place during winter.
